You are booking hotel for more than 90 days
Overberg, Overberg
Overberg
Overberg
Breede River DC
Overberg
Caledon
Swellendam
Caledon
Swellendam
Breede River DC
Overberg
L'Agulhas
Van Dyks Bay
Gansbaai
Van Dyks Bay
Van Dyks Bay
Overberg
Swellendam
Overberg
Caledon
Overberg
Overberg
Overberg
Caledon
Overberg
Caledon
Overberg
Swellendam
Swellendam
Sandbaai
Knysna
Fisher Haven
Oudtshoorn
Gardens
Simola Golf and Country Estate
Thesen Island
Knysna
Knysna
Melkbosstrand